文档详情

基于Web的在线学习平台的设计与实现-开题报告.docx

发布:2025-01-19约2.83千字共6页下载文档
文本预览下载声明

PAGE

1-

基于Web的在线学习平台的设计与实现-开题报告

一、项目背景与意义

(1)随着信息技术的飞速发展,网络教育逐渐成为我国教育领域的重要组成部分。基于Web的在线学习平台作为一种新型的教育模式,为学习者提供了便捷、灵活的学习方式。近年来,我国在线教育市场规模不断扩大,用户数量持续增长,这为在线学习平台的发展提供了广阔的市场空间。本项目旨在设计并实现一个功能完善、用户体验良好的在线学习平台,以满足用户多样化的学习需求,推动我国在线教育的普及与发展。

(2)在当前教育体制下,传统的教学模式存在一定的局限性,如学习资源有限、学习时间受限等。而基于Web的在线学习平台可以有效解决这些问题。通过互联网,学习者可以随时随地访问平台,获取丰富的学习资源,实现个性化学习。此外,在线学习平台还可以通过大数据、人工智能等技术手段,为学习者提供更加精准的学习推荐,提高学习效率。因此,本项目具有重要的现实意义,有助于推动我国教育信息化进程。

(3)本项目的研究与实现将有助于丰富我国在线学习平台的理论体系,为后续相关研究提供参考。同时,项目成果将为我国在线教育产业的发展提供技术支持,有助于提升我国在线教育的整体水平。此外,本项目的成功实施还将为用户提供一个优质的学习平台,有助于提高学习者的综合素质,为我国培养更多优秀人才。因此,本项目不仅具有理论价值,更具有实际应用价值。

二、国内外研究现状

(1)国外在线学习平台的研究起步较早,技术相对成熟。以美国为例,Coursera、edX等大型在线学习平台已经积累了丰富的教学资源和用户数据,通过大数据分析为学习者提供个性化的学习路径。此外,国外在线学习平台在移动学习、虚拟现实等领域的研究也取得了显著成果,如利用虚拟现实技术模拟真实教学场景,提高学习者的沉浸感。

(2)国内在线学习平台的研究起步较晚,但发展迅速。近年来,我国政府高度重视在线教育的发展,出台了一系列政策支持在线教育平台的建设。目前,国内在线学习平台主要集中在课程资源整合、在线教学、学习社区等方面。例如,网易云课堂、腾讯课堂等平台通过整合优质教育资源,为学习者提供多样化的学习选择。同时,国内平台在移动学习、人工智能辅助教学等方面也取得了一定的成果。

(3)在国内外研究现状的基础上,当前在线学习平台的研究热点主要集中在以下几个方面:一是个性化学习路径的设计与实现;二是基于大数据的学习分析与应用;三是移动学习与泛在学习环境的构建;四是虚拟现实与增强现实技术在教育领域的应用。这些研究方向的深入探讨将有助于推动在线学习平台的创新发展,为用户提供更加优质、高效的学习体验。

三、系统需求分析

(1)根据用户调研和数据分析,在线学习平台需满足以下基本需求。首先,用户注册与登录功能需简便易用,确保用户能够快速创建账户并登录系统。据统计,注册流程过于复杂将导致用户流失率提高约20%。其次,课程分类清晰,便于用户根据兴趣和需求选择课程。例如,根据不同年龄段和职业特点,设置少儿、职场、兴趣等多个分类,满足不同用户的学习需求。此外,课程搜索功能需高效准确,用户平均搜索时间应控制在3秒以内。

(2)在内容需求方面,平台需提供丰富的教学资源,包括视频、文档、音频等多种形式。据统计,拥有超过1000门课程的在线学习平台用户满意度更高。同时,课程内容需定期更新,以保持时效性和实用性。以某知名在线学习平台为例,其每月更新课程内容达200余门,确保用户能够接触到最新的知识。此外,平台还应提供互动性强的学习工具,如在线讨论区、作业提交与批改等,以增强用户的学习体验。

(3)在功能需求方面,在线学习平台需具备以下特点。一是用户管理功能,包括用户信息管理、权限管理、课程订阅管理等,确保平台安全稳定运行。据统计,具备完善用户管理功能的平台,用户活跃度提高约30%。二是教学管理功能,如课程发布、课程进度跟踪、成绩管理等,以支持教师高效开展教学工作。例如,某在线教育机构通过引入教学管理功能,教师平均教学效率提高了40%。三是数据分析与报告功能,通过分析用户学习行为、课程访问量等数据,为平台优化和决策提供依据。据相关数据显示,具备数据分析功能的在线学习平台,用户留存率可提高约25%。

四、系统设计与实现

(1)系统架构设计采用分层架构,包括表现层、业务逻辑层和数据访问层。表现层负责用户界面展示,采用HTML5、CSS3和JavaScript等技术实现响应式设计,确保在不同设备上均有良好体验。业务逻辑层负责处理用户请求,实现课程管理、用户管理、学习进度跟踪等功能。数据访问层负责与数据库交互,采用MySQL数据库存储用户数据、课程信息等。

(2)在功能实现方面,系统具备以下特点。首先,用户注册与登录功能支持多种认证方式,包括手机号、邮箱和第三方账号登录,提高用户体验。其次,课程

显示全部
相似文档